Something to Call Perfect

Skies of blue, and flowers full of vivid colors

Gazing upon the shimmering surface of these waters

The light does such wonders

To shed even a single tear at the sight of beauty,

For how soothing is the sound of Mother Nature's melody

There is no sadness here,

Nor is there a thing to fear,

Yet from your eye still falls that tear

Is it so difficult to accept?

Something so close to perfect,

That you must call it just that,

From the ground beneath to the skies above

Drifting in the feeling of love,

A place most only dream of

Where monsters cowardly hide

I have a secret

Between you and I,

The grass really is greener on the other side
